It should engage learners and make them part of learning. The purpose of this study was to establish factors influencing pre-school teachers’ use of teaching aids to enhance learning in pre-primary schools. The study was carried out in Isinya Sub-county, Kenya. The target population was pre-primary school teachers in selected schools in Isinya Sub- County. Data was collected through the use of questionnaire and an observation schedule .A sample size of 20 schools of the target population was drawn from the pre-schools. Descriptive statistics was used to analyze data. Data is presented using tables, graphs and pie charts. The study revealed that several factors influenced the use of teaching aids in pre-schools which included; non-availability of teaching aids, teachers’ attitude and perceptions on particular teaching aids.
